Wolf spider pressure is elevated in active new construction zones and properties adjacent to remaining farmland. ## Spider Pressure in Binbrook Spider pressure in Binbrook follows Hamilton patterns, with the most common species being house spiders, cellar spiders, and wolf spiders in residential settings. Orb weavers appear on exterior structures in late summer. Species specific to the local environment (waterfront areas, cottage properties, ravine adjacency) are noted above. The dominant entry routes are foundation gaps, window frame weatherstripping, and garage door seals. Exterior perimeter treatment at these zones is the most effective way to reduce indoor spider pressure. ## Mosquito Control in Binbrook Lower mosquito pressure than waterfront or marsh-adjacent communities, but treatment remains effective for properties with outdoor living spaces. ## Tick Control in Binbrook Lower tick risk than rural or cottage-country areas. Service scheduling depends on current availability in the Hamilton area. ## Treatment Details **What gets treated:** Foundation perimeter, window frames and sills, door frames and thresholds, soffits, eaves, and (where applicable) garage exterior. Interior basement and garage spot treatment is available on request. **Products used:** Suspend Polyzone or Dragnet (bifenthrin SC formulation) — professional-grade, PMRA-registered. 30–90 day residual depending on weather and surface conditions. **Re-entry:** Children and pets should stay off treated surfaces until dry (30–60 minutes). No interior preparation required for standard exterior treatment. **Guarantee:** Free respray within 2 weeks if spider activity persists after treatment.
